Description
Kyle suggests that engaging small groups in hands-on exploration of AI tools can foster a culture of innovation and adaptability, allowing employees to learn through practical experience. The dialogue also touches on the necessity of addressing the fears and misconceptions surrounding AI, encouraging a balanced view that acknowledges both the potential benefits and the inherent flaws of these technologies.
The session further explores various AI applications, emphasizing the significance of practical, user-friendly tools that can be easily adopted by individuals and organizations alike. Kyle highlights the value of "parlor tricks" — simple, engaging AI demonstrations that showcase the technology's capabilities without overwhelming users. This approach aims to demystify AI and encourage broader participation in its adoption, creating a community of learners who can share insights and experiences. By fostering an environment where curiosity and playfulness thrive, the channel seeks to empower viewers to embrace the rapidly changing world of AI technology.

think this is essentially you get 43:16 AGI I mean this could be okay so 43:21 important backdrop if you don't know 43:25 this Microsoft invested Ed 10 billion or 43:29 11 billion they invested 1 billion and 43:31 then they did 10 billion I was never 43:33 clear if it was on top of the 1 billion 43:35 or in you know including the 1 billion 43:38 but anyway they invested a [ __ ] ton of 43:40 money largely in the form of cloud 43:45 services to open AI for 49% of the 43:48 company but in their 43:52 agreement it states that when 43:56 AI when open 43:58 AI achieves AGI or artificial general 44:03 intelligence the commercial agreement 44:06 between open Ai and Microsoft is 44:10 severed for for that product I they I 44:13 assume they can still use all the [ __ ] 44:14 that's not AGI but once open AI hits AGI 44:18 artificial general 44:20 intelligence Microsoft no longer has 44:24 rights to that like from commercially 44:28 so it's a it's a it's a big turning 44:30 point it's
